simplify
'simplify' - used as a verb
1. make simpler or easier or reduce in complexity or extent
We had to simplify the instructions
this move will simplify our lives

derived forms
1. Simplify / Past
simplified
2. Simplify / Third Person
simplifies
3. Simplify / Present Participle
simplifying
Variations of 'simplify'
 
Antonym
  • complicate
